How digital trip planning eases the load for families
With children there is a lot to think about before a trip. Accommodation, journey, ideas for outings, check-in times, shopping list and maybe entertainment for a rainy day. When all this information is stored in one place, no one has to hunt for printed emails or loose notes shortly before departure.
It is especially useful to have key details ready on your smartphone. That helps when you arrive, when you contact your accommodation and whenever you need to change plans on the way.
Which documents are worth sorting digitally
For a paperless North Sea holiday to work in everyday life, a simple structure makes a difference. Before you travel, create a separate folder on your smartphone or in the cloud and collect everything you need there.
- Booking confirmation for your accommodation
- Address and contact details
- Travel information and timetables
- Reservations for excursions or ferries
- Digital packing list
- Notes on shopping, medication or daily plans
Clear file names are just as helpful. That way you can quickly find what you need, even when time is short.
Travel better prepared instead of searching on the go
Many families know these moments: just before you set off, something is still missing, the weather changes or a child suddenly needs a break. This is when digital preparation pays off. If you maintain packing lists on your phone, you can adjust them at any time and simply reuse them for your next holiday.
It also helps to have a short overview for the first day of your trip. It only needs the essentials: arrival time, key handover, the nearest supermarket and the things you will need straight after you get there. That makes the start of your holiday calmer.
More overview at your destination, less loose paper
It is often at your destination that the benefits of paperless travel become clear. Instead of scattered slips of paper in bags, jackets or rucksacks, all information is stored in one place. This saves space and reduces the risk of losing or forgetting something.
A shared solution is also helpful for families. If both adults have access to bookings, addresses and lists, planning stays relaxed even when one person is already at the beach with the children and the other is still taking care of something.
Tips for a safe paperless holiday
- Save important documents offline as a backup
- Charge your phone fully before outings
- Use a simple and clear folder structure
- Do not store all logins and reservations in just one app
- Check before departure that all documents are complete
Your digital setup does not have to be perfect. What matters is that it works in real family life. Less searching, fewer loose sheets, less rushing around: this is what makes a paperless North Sea holiday so practical.
